Hi,

 

I have a requirement of some free ports from an existing access switch in out network environment. I have collected the information of free ports based on the below interface counter statistics.

 

Last input never, output never, output hang never
Last clearing of "show interface" counters never

 

However, this switch got rebooted few weeks ago. so my question is,

1. Will the last input/output counter reset itself when the switch got rebooted? or can we consider this port has never been used even before the reboot of the switch?

 

Due to the COVID19, users never used the office since last one year. But this switch is running last 4 years. Kindly clarify my doubt please. Thanks in advance.

try this command good :

 

sh interfaces | include line protocol | [0-9].[y+w]

sh interface | inc line protocol | Last input never, output never

sh interfaces | inc line protocol | [3-9].[y+w]

 

we use automated script to get information and generate report based on the outcome (out of the box)
